What does Creedyn mean and where does it come from?

Creedyn is a relatively modern name that combines the concept of 'creed' with a playful twist at the end. It reflects a deep belief and is often favored in contemporary naming trends in the U.S. and Ireland. The name has gained attention in recent decades and is often seen as unique yet accessible.

The story of Creedyn

Creedyn is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 2015. With 20 total births recorded, Creedyn remains relatively uncommon.
